
Suggest Treatment For Eczema Post Child Delivery

Question: wife has hypothyroidism after the second delivery in 2012.last year she developed a eczema like skin problem on her leg.it had a symmetric pattern on both legs.
treatment was done and it got cured.but the scar is left behind.we r planning to use mederma to get rid of the scar.request your expert opinion on removing the scar.pic attached

Brief Answer:
I suggest a possibility of Post-inflammatory Hyperpigmentation /PIH
Detailed Answer:
Hello. Thank you for writing to us at healthcaremagic
I have gone through your query and I have reviewed the Image.
This is post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ation /PIH. PIH is a non-specific reaction to any inflammatory insult to skin and presents as dark patches.
I would suggest you to use a mid potent steroid e.g Mometasone furaote 0.1% cream, twice daily for 3-4 weeks. This would lighten it up gradually.
